Canucks hoping to get their hands on a Longines timepiece are in luck.
More than a decade after introducing its online store, the Swiss watchmaker has expanded its digital offerings into Canada, allowing customers to purchase pieces directly through Longines’ website with free delivery countrywide.
“This new e-commerce platform brings our customers closer to Longines than ever before,” says CEO, Matthias Breschan. “It offers all the convenience and confidence of shopping online with the service one can expect from the brand. We want to provide the best experience possible 24-7, from any corner of the country.”
The boutique offers an array of services, including a watch comparison tool, information about the brand’s history, free shipping and returns, secured payment methods, and access to local customer service. It is available in both English and French.
Longines launched its first online store in the United States in 2010. Today, its e-commerce boutiques are available in more than 15 countries, with more openings planned in the near future.
